In a move to bolster its military capability, Mongolia is set to modernize its air force and plans to invest in an Earth-observation satellite. The Mongolian defense budget accounts for 1.5% of gross domestic product, but "we're now debating making defense 4% of GDP," Defense Minister Luvsanvandan Bold told Aviation Week on the sidelines of the Shangri-La Dialogue Asian security summit here. The economy is also growing at more than 10% per year, he adds.
